People who are dependent on alcohol or drugs may not reach out for the help they require, before it is too late. Family members usually have to intervene to obtain them help, and it is important that anyone trying to find effective alcohol and drug rehab understand what kinds of drug rehab in Huntington, IN. can be found and those that will prove most ideal. Not every drug rehab in Huntington, Indiana is the same, for instance you will find short term alcohol and drug treatment facilities and long-term facilities, and also outpatient and inpatient programs. There are also residential facilities, and such a drug rehab in Huntington is a perfect environment for individuals who choose a long-term treatment option, because they'll be in drug rehab in Huntington, IN. for a while and these types of centers offer many of the comforts and amenities of home.

Lots of people looking for drug rehab in Huntington, Indiana or their family who are seeking a rehabilitation option lean towards programs and rehab facilities that can return the addicted person home and also to their normal everyday lives immediately. Naturally anybody who is in drug rehab desires to make it through the process and get return to their obligations, families, etc. as quickly as possible. This is the reason outpatient and short-term drug rehab in Huntington looks like ideal rehab alternative for addicted individuals and their families. Quite often however, individuals develop a strong physical and in many cases psychological dependency to drugs and alcohol making these seemingly convenient drug rehab in Huntington, IN. choices unworkable.

While at first in any type of drug rehab in Huntington, Indiana, people who are recently abstaining from alcohol and drugs are detoxed and ideally assisted through this, with withdrawal made more manageable through the help of detox professionals. Even with someone is detoxed however, they are still going to experience intense cravings to drink or use drugs, cravings which can persist for quite a while. Some people claim that they experience such cravings for the remainder of their lives, but ideally cope through them with the life tools and effective coping methods they obtain within an effective Huntington drug rehab. Let's say someone is in an outpatient drug rehab in Huntington, IN. while still encountering these intense cravings, and go back home daily when it's in rehab. Studies indicate that substance abuse is often times triggered by environmental factors, such as life stressors, or perhaps people in their environment who may trigger it. This may be an abusive relationship, someone that promotes and participates in the person's habit or some other situation that may cause the individual to go to alcohol or drugs as a social aid, as an escape or to self medicate. This makes an outpatient situation the least ideal, since the whole reason for drug rehab in Huntington, Indiana should be to resolve all of these scenarios while there. This is why relapses are very typical with outpatient drug rehab.

Likewise, short-term drug rehab in Huntington which provides treatment for four weeks or fewer are truly the least ideal rehab settings even when receiving inpatient or residential rehabilitation. As mentioned earlier, those who have recently abstained from drugs and alcohol need quite a bit of time to recover physically and really stabilize from the dependence a result of their substance abuse. After only a few weeks, individuals in drug rehab in Huntington, IN. are merely adjusting to a drug free lifestyle, and finding out how to adjust physically, mentally, and emotionally without their drug of choice. This leaves very little time so they can clearly target what can actually help them to conserve a drug-free and healthy lifestyle when they return home, which may take quite some time for those who may need to make significant and life changing choices and lifestyle changes.

Long-term drug rehab in Huntington, Indiana is an ideal rehabilitation option for various reasons, but first and foremost it provides the required change of environment as well as the intensity of treatment needed for those who desire to reap all the benefits of rehab and also sustain these successes when they return home to their normal lives. Long-term drug rehab in Huntington is available in either an inpatient or residential treatment center, with the main differences being inpatient offers treatment services for those who make require medical treatment as part of their rehabilitation process. This might be true for a person who's experiencing a physical ailment or life-threatening disease which has been worsened due to their drug use, or somebody who might require help being weaned off of medical drugs that they have grown to be dependent to.

With regards to long-term residential drug rehab in Huntington, IN., these facilities offer a lot of the comforts of home hence the individual can feel comfortable during the often lengthy drug rehab process. While it is hard to be away from family members while in treatment for several months, this sort of center helps it be much easier to endure through the process. And after all, the sacrifice is worth it in the end once the individual can go back home prepared to live a happy, productive and drug free lifestyle.
